TRIDHA couldn’t hear the cries of a three-year-old?

Tridha child sexual abuse case

The blog is not a news reporting site but yesterday when we saw a leading newspaper daily, carry details of the incident in the most diplomatic way, we at MaaOfAllBlogs could not let go. Parents from Tridha approached us to carry this story as they want their voices to reach to millions out there so here it is, the uncut version;

TRIDHA is the name given to the goddess that represents Durga, Lakshmi, and Saraswati and it is also the name given to a School in Andheri East. Unfortunately, the school and mothers of hundreds of children going to the school turned a deaf ear to the cries of a three-year-old. If this is what happens in an Elitist Urban School then I shudder to think about the plight of scores of children who get molested every day in this country.

Yesterday, Mumbai High Court ordered Patrick Brillant, Tridha School Trustee, accused of sexually assaulting a three-year-old and charged under POCSO to remain out of School till further orders. Ideally, in the first place, the school should have taken a preventive measure and kept the accuse away from school premises on it’s own.

But that did not happen. He resumed active duties while on bail. He not only resumed his school duties and but also started what any accused would do – influence the people around.

Why did the parents of Tridha not ensure that the Trustee does not come to School while on bail? Why such a callous attitude towards the mother of a three-year-old who is fighting a lonely battle to get justice for her child? When we read of the chain of events, these were the questions that popped into our heads.

On 18 May 2017 parents of the three-year-old girl had lodged an FIR against Patrick Brillant, French national and an Active Trustee of Tridha School in Mumbai. He was accused of sexually assaulting the girl. But it took the police six months to arrest Patrick in a POCSO case where the law states that the case has to be heard and a judgement given in one year! What is more surprising is that the arrest was made only after the girl’s parents filed a writ petition in the Mumbai High Court.

Within 15 days of arrest, Patrick was granted an unconditional bail. Shockingly, another trustee, Ruth Mehta, sent a mail to all parents suggesting that the worst is over for Tridha and welcomed Patrick in the School and among children. Did she not even think for a second for another mother who was running pillar to post trying to seek justice? Isn’t she responsible for what happened to that child in the school? Did she even hear the child’s mother or help the child get assistance to face the trauma?

On 5th January 2018 Charge sheet was finally filed but the accused was roaming free in the school. Interestingly, a section of parents was writing to the school trying to explain that the school cannot allow Patrick to resume duties while on bail and interact with children thus putting other kids at risk. But their pleas went unheard.

In fact, an anxious parent even wrote separately to the school Principal and the other two trustees asking them why she should send her child to the school when Patrick Brillant, an accused is roaming freely among children there. Patrick responded to that mail out of turn in which he equated himself to Mahatma Gandhi and Nelson Mandela. Even Media reported this blasphemy. Even then hundreds of other parents did not find anything wrong with this.

Left with no choice, some parents decided to file an intervening application in the High Court to restrict Patrick Brillant from entering the School premises alongside the Bail Cancellation application filed by the girl’s parents.
